Significance of Ingot Purity in Manufacturing

The purity of ingots is critical to the success of many manufacturing processes. High-purity ingots ensure consistent product quality and capabilities. Impurities can introduce defects, weakening the strength and durability of finished goods. Furthermore, impure materials can modify the properties of alloys, making it difficult to achieve desired outcomes. To mitigate these risks, manufacturers strictly adhere rigorous quality control measures throughout the ingot production process.
